The Crucial Role of Roof Flashing
Imagine your roof as a sophisticated shield against the often-unpredictable New England weather. Rain, snow, and ice are constant challenges, and while shingles or metal roofing layers handle the bulk of water runoff, certain areas require a more specialized approach. These include chimneys, vent pipes, skylights, dormers, and where roof planes meet. Without proper flashing, water can seep into the attic, down wall cavities, and even into the foundation, leading to mold growth, rot, structural damage, and compromised insulation. Many homes in Cumberland, particularly those built in earlier decades, may exhibit aging or improperly installed original flashing that can degrade over time due to expansion and contraction, UV exposure, and harsh weather conditions.
Common Roof Flashing Issues in Cumberland
The climate in Cumberland, characterized by hot summers and cold, snowy winters, can take a toll on roof flashing. Here are some common issues that homeowners and business owners in and around Cumberland might encounter:
Rust and Corrosion: Metal flashing, especially older galvanized steel types, is susceptible to rust, particularly in areas with high humidity or prolonged exposure to moisture.
Cracked or Deteriorated Sealant: The caulking or sealant used in conjunction with flashing can dry out, crack, and become brittle over time, creating entry points for water.
Loose or Lifted Flashing: Wind uplift from storms, a common occurrence in Rhode Island, can loosen or completely lift flashing sections, exposing the underlying roof deck.
Improper Installation: Flashing that was not installed correctly from the outset, with inadequate overlap or insufficient nailing, will inevitably lead to leaks.
Age and Wear: Like all building materials, flashing has a lifespan. Over many years, it can wear down, become brittle, or be damaged by debris.

Inspection and Diagnosis
A skilled roofing technician will systematically examine all areas where flashing is present, looking for any signs of damage, displacement, or deterioration. This often involves accessing the roof safely and using their expertise to identify the root cause of any potential leaks.
Preparation and Repair Methods
Depending on the extent of the damage, the repair method will vary:
Sealant Replacement: For minor issues with cracked sealant, the old material will be meticulously removed, and a high-quality, weather-resistant sealant specifically designed for roofing applications will be applied.
Re-nailing or Securing: If flashing has become loose, it will be carefully re-secured using appropriate fasteners. Sometimes, additional fasteners are needed to ensure a permanent bond.
Flashing Replacement: For severely damaged, rusted, or deteriorated flashing, a section or the entire piece will be removed and replaced with new material. This ensures a long-lasting repair and prevents future issues. Common materials used include aluminum, copper, and galvanized steel, chosen for their durability and compatibility with your existing roof.
Integrating New With Old: When replacing sections, professionals ensure the new flashing overlaps correctly with the existing material and is properly integrated with the roofing membrane to create a watertight seal.
Materials and Tools of the Trade
Roofing contractors in Cumberland utilize a range of specialized tools and materials to perform effective flashing repairs:
Materials: Sheet metal (aluminum, copper, galvanized steel), specialized roofing sealants and flashing cements, butyl tape, and sometimes synthetic flashing membranes.
Tools: Utility knives, caulk guns, pry bars, hammers, nail guns (for certain applications), metal snips, shovels, safety harnesses, and ladders.

Frequently Asked Questions About Roof Flashing Repair
What are the signs I need roof flashing repair in Cumberland given our weather?
In Cumberland, with its distinct four seasons and potential for heavy rain and snow, you should be particularly vigilant for signs of flashing problems. Look for water stains on your ceilings or walls, especially near chimneys, vents, or skylights. You might also observe crumbling sealant around flashing points, rust spots on metal flashing, or loose or visibly damaged flashing materials on your roof. Any of these indicators warrant a professional inspection, as our region’s weather can quickly exacerbate minor issues.
How often should roof flashing be inspected in the Cumberland area?
It is generally recommended to have your roof flashing inspected at least once a year, and ideally, once in the spring and once in the fall. This proactive approach allows for the detection and repair of minor issues before they become major leaks, especially considering the impact of winter ice dams and spring thaws that can severely stress flashing components in the Cumberland climate.

Storm Risk & Climate Factors — Cumberland, Rhode Island
The county surrounding Cumberland averages 0.2 significant hail events per year (hail diameter ≥ 1"). High-wind events average 7.7 per year. Source: NOAA National Centers for Environmental Information, Storm Events Database, 2014–2023.
With 5,690 annual heating degree days, Cumberland is in a climate where ice dams are a real seasonal hazard — attic heat escapes through the roof deck, melts snow, and the meltwater refreezes at the cold eaves, backing up under shingles and causing interior moisture damage. Proper attic insulation, air sealing, and ice-and-water shield at the eaves are the primary defenses. Source: Open-Meteo ERA5 Climate Reanalysis, 2014–2023 average.

Will homeowners insurance cover Roof Flashing Repair in Cumberland?
Insurance typically covers sudden storm damage — hail, wind, and falling trees — but not gradual wear or pre-existing deterioration. Document all damage with photos immediately after a storm and contact your insurer before any repair work begins.
Can I do Roof Flashing Repair myself?
Replacing one or two displaced shingles is manageable for a confident DIYer with proper ladder safety; flashing repairs around chimneys and valleys require complex sealing and are best handled by a licensed roofer
